Joan Vassos and Chock Chapple aren’t planning their wedding just yet

Joan Vasoss has an update on her wedding plans for her fans, but it’s probably not the update they were hoping for. Vassos sat down with Life & Style recently to chat about life. She told the publication that she and Chapple haven’t actually nailed down any wedding plans. In fact, she insists. They haven’t even begun talking about it. There is no location, date, or theme picked out yet.

She insists that there is nothing wrong between them. Vassos contends that they’ve just been busy with other things. Vassos is already wrapped up in planning a different wedding, and she has several upcoming plans that will keep her busy through the fall. Much of her attention has gone to her son’s wedding. Nicholas Vassos is set to wed in August. She revealed that she and Chapple have some events in the fall to look forward to, as well. Once winter sets in, she is confident that planning will get underway.

The reality TV personality seems to be sticking to her original plan

While some The Golden Bachelorette fans are concerned about the lack of movement in the couple’s relationship, it actually tracks with what Vassos said before flying out to California to film season 1 of The Golden Bachelorette. In May 2024, Joan Vassos told CNN that fans were unlikely to see a second, quick golden wedding. At the time, she said she wasn’t opposed to leaving the show engaged but did want to spend some time seeing her beau operate in the real world before making any legal commitment.

So far, she’s done just that. She and Chapple left the show engaged. Since then, they’ve been spending time together but don’t reside in the same state. They actually seem to be enjoying the dynamic of long-distance courting.

Vassos is no stranger to commtiment. She was married to her late husband, John Vassos, for 32 years. He died in 2021 from pancreatic cancer. Chapple is divorced once and lost a long-term partner. He was engaged for nine years before appearing on the show. Chapple’s late fiancée died of cancer in 2022.
